This is a photograph of a stone staircase with a small white dog perched on it. The image is captured in black and white, showcasing a set of stone steps that descend from an upper level, casting strong shadows due to the angle of the sunlight. The staircase is flanked by stone walls, creating a narrow alley or path leading downwards. The texture of the cobblestones and the masonry of the walls are emphasized by the lighting, which creates stark contrasts between light and shadow. The presence of the small white dog adds a focal point amidst the geometric lines and textures of the environment. The overall composition gives a sense of solitude and quietude in an urban setting.
